I'm looking for a holster for a Springfield Micro Compact .45 with a 3" barrel. It must have these specifics:
1) Outside the waistband
2) Leather
3) thumb break snapped enclosure on the inside of the holster
4) strap must be the type that keeps the hammer back, in the cocked position
5) black in color

Seems I can find some of these features on different holsters, but not all of them on one holster. It must exist! I'm pickey, but c'mon.

I would think - although you should confirm this by phone - that pretty much any holster that will fit a 3" Kimber that fits your retention requirement would fit the micro compact pistol. Am I wrong, or is the primary size difference between the two pistols that the SA has a 6+1 capacity and shorter grip frame than the 7+1 capacity and slightly longer grip frame of the Kimber? If that is the case, then the holster would fit either pistol.
  1. Galco Cop Slide
  2. Galco Fletch High Ride Belt Holster
  3. Galco Gladius Belt Holster
  4. Galco Paddle Lite Holster
  5. Galco Silhouette Hight Ride Holster
  6. Desantis Thumb Break Scabbard
  7. Desantis Thumb Break Mini Slide
  8. Desantis Viper Paddle with Thumb Break
  9. Bianchi Black Widow
  10. Bianchi Special Agent
  11. Bianchi AccuMold Belt Slide
Let's see... that's 11 variants from reputable manufacturers, all available in black with thumb snaps. All but the last one are in leather, but it might still fit your purpose. That wasn't that hard. I thought you were going to make me work to find one.
